返回

HTML&&CSS记录笔记——深入解析盒子模型的奥秘

前端

今天是HTML和CSS学习之旅的第六天,我们要一起探索盒子模型的世界。盒子模型是Web设计中一个非常重要的概念,它决定了元素在页面上的布局和外观。通过对盒子模型的深入理解,我们可以更有效地控制页面布局,并创建出美观、响应式和用户友好的网站。

什么是盒子模型?

盒子模型是W3C制定的一个标准,它定义了元素在页面上的布局和外观。根据盒子模型,每个元素都被看作是一个矩形盒子,这个盒子由四部分组成:

  • 内容:元素的实际内容,如文本、图像或视频。
  • 内边距:内容和边框之间的区域。
  • 边框:元素周围的线。
  • 外边距:元素与其他元素之间的区域。

盒子模型的组成部分

1. 内容(Content)

内容是指元素内部的实际内容,如文本、图像、视频等。内容的宽度和高度由元素的CSS属性width和height控制。

2. 内边距(Padding)

内边距是指内容和边框之间的区域。内边距的宽度和高度由元素的CSS属性padding-top、padding-right、padding-bottom和padding-left控制。

3. 边框(Border)

边框是指元素周围的线。边框的宽度、颜色和样式由元素的CSS属性border-width、border-color和border-style控制。

4. 外边距(Margin)

外边距是指元素与其他元素之间的区域。外边距的宽度和高度由元素的CSS属性margin-top、margin-right、margin-bottom和margin-left控制。

盒子模型的影响因素

盒子模型的各个组成部分都会影响元素的最终外观和布局。例如,内容的宽度和高度会决定元素的大小,内边距的宽度和高度会决定内容与边框之间的距离,边框的宽度、颜色和样式会决定元素的边框外观,外边距的宽度和高度会决定元素与其他元素之间的距离。

掌握盒子模型的好处

掌握盒子模型可以为我们带来以下好处:

  • 更有效地控制页面布局。通过对盒子模型的理解,我们可以更轻松地控制元素在页面上的位置和大小。
  • 创建出美观、响应式和用户友好的网站。通过合理运用盒子模型,我们可以创建出更美观、更响应式、更用户友好的网站。
  • 提高代码的可读性和可维护性。通过对盒子模型的理解,我们可以编写出更可读、更可维护的CSS代码。

盒子模型的应用场景

盒子模型在Web设计中有着广泛的应用场景,例如:

  • 布局页面。我们可以通过盒子模型来布局页面,使元素在页面上排列整齐、美观。
  • 创建响应式网站。我们可以通过盒子模型来创建响应式网站,使网站在不同设备上都能完美显示。
  • 设计用户界面。我们可以通过盒子模型来设计用户界面,使界面更加美观、友好。

结语

盒子模型是Web设计中一个非常重要的概念,掌握盒子模型可以为我们带来诸多好处。通过对盒子模型的深入理解,我们可以更有效地控制页面布局,并创建出美观、响应式和用户友好的网站。